I thought I had a friend
I thought I had a friend
But only to find out
She talks behind my back
Saying I'm a fake friend
She's done a lot for me
And I could say I tried
I tried putting in effort
But still
I was still called a fake friend
Again
Again
And Again
I let it slide
While knowing it hurts
I thought I had a friend
But no I had a snake pet
Which I loved
But
I didn't know
It would just turn its back on me
Which hugged me tight
Just to finish me off
My heart teared to pieces
Not just apart
Pieces
I found myself crying
Yes I cried
I laughed
And saw how stupid I was
I thought I had a knife
For slicing bread
Chopping veggies and stuff
But I ended up cutting myself with that knife
Ended up Chopping onions
Just to see my tears drop a deadbeat
For a moment I thought
I have
I thought
I had
But no
Those were only imaginations
Actually they were memories
That were made
And that will always
And I mean always flashback
Every second
I think about
What I thought I had
About this poem
This poem is about a friend that turned her back on her friend and always pretending that she loves her but she talks behind her back saying bad stuff
